How to serialize or convert Swift objects to JSON?

In Swift, we typically use the Codable protocol to handle serialization and deserialization between objects and JSON. Codable is a type alias for the Encodable and Decodable protocols, enabling data models to be both encoded and decoded.

1. Define the Data Model

First, verify that your data model conforms to the Codable protocol. This enables Swift to utilize JSONEncoder and JSONDecoder for encoding and decoding.

swift
struct User: Codable { var name: String var age: Int var email: String? }

In this example, we define a User struct with name, age, and an optional email property.

2. Create an Object Instance

Next, create an instance of the object you wish to serialize.

swift
let user = User(name: "张三", age: 28, email: "zhangsan@example.com")

3. Use JSONEncoder for Serialization

Utilize JSONEncoder to serialize the object into JSON data.

swift
do { let jsonData = try JSONEncoder().encode(user) if let jsonString = String(data: jsonData, encoding: .utf8) { print("JSON String: " + jsonString) } } catch { print("Error serializing JSON: \(error)") }

In this code snippet, we first attempt to encode the user object into JSON data. If successful, we convert the data into a string for display.

4. Error Handling

Be aware that using JSONEncoder can throw errors; therefore, implementing do-catch statements for error handling is crucial.

Conclusion

By following these steps, you can serialize any Swift object that conforms to the Codable protocol into JSON. This is particularly valuable for network data transmission and local data storage. For example, when developing an application that requires saving user settings locally, you can convert the user settings object model into JSON and store it in UserDefaults or a file. This method is concise and type-safe, greatly minimizing the risk of errors.
